Kim Newman is the Black female leader the tech industry didn’t know they needed.
BAY AREA, CA — Kim Newman came to the Transformations of the Human (ToftH) in October of 2020 to help design and oversee the launch of the ToftH School: a seven month one of a kind experimental curriculum that brings together philosophy, art, and technology in a single practice we call PArT. 

Kim –– mom of two (humans) and three (dogs) –– has a history of connecting technology, the arts, education, and research. She has co-founded startups, worked as senior administrator in top universities, and as business executive for top 50 Forbes companies. Kim’s belief in the power of ideas, her commitment to building educational institutions, and her belief in the world-changing potential of technology sustains her optimism that combining philosophical research, art, and product development can ensure a more prosperous and sustainable future for all. 
“I am motivated and intrigued by the idea of a curriculum that enrolls students in planetary thinking. A major failing of today’s education institutions is separating the arts from the sciences and engineering. If we are to become planetary, we have to overcome these separations. ToftH does just that: it is one big experiment in bringing together fields like philosophy, AI, biogeochemistry and art in a single framework. ”
— Kim Newman
